Congressional Summary of HR 2509

This bill directs the Department of Transportation to recommend ways to reduce helicopter and rotorcraft noise in the District of Columbia, including recommendations on altitude, the number of flights, flight paths, and pilot training.

Current Status of Bill HR 2509

Bill HR 2509 is currently in the status of Introduced to House since April 6, 2023. Bill HR 2509 was introduced during Congress 118 and was introduced to the House on April 6, 2023.  Bill HR 2509's most recent activity was Sponsor introductory remarks on measure. (CR E299) as of April 10, 2023
